The Teratec symposium on simulation and high performance computing (HPC) will take place on 3 and 4 June in Evry, France.

The symposium will consist of plenary lectures and workshops on the use of simulation in many areas of research and industry, on the evolution of technology (systems and software) and on the training of specialists.

The first day will focus on major HPC programmes in the US, Japan and Europe, followed by a presentation on technological developments and HPC views on four main sectors: automotive, space research, oil exploration, and energy.

On the second day of the event, three specialised workshops will address material science, challenges in the petaflops-range computing, and visualisation-multimedia in HPC. A special seminar will be dedicated to questions of cooperation between France and the US.For further information, please visit:
